Ghost Sensations Across the Body: Trait and State Differences in Spontaneous Somatic Experience
Myrto Efstathiou1, Louise S Delicato2, Anna Sedda2
1School of Psychology and Counselling, The Open University, Faculty of Arts and Social Sciences, Milton Keynes, UK.
Spontaneous sensations (SPS) differ based on body region and awareness type. Habitual SPS reflect a global body model, while momentary SPS arise from sensory input, neither linked to visual attention skills.

Background:
- Spontaneous sensations (SPS) are unexplained bodily feelings like tingling or itching.
- These sensations offer insights into the body's perceptual mechanisms.
- Understanding SPS can illuminate the relationship between body representation and sensory processing.
Purpose of the Study:
- To investigate how spontaneous sensations (SPS) vary across different body regions (hands, feet, whole body).
- To examine the influence of individual differences in visual attention on SPS experiences.
- To differentiate between habitual (SPSTrait) and momentary (SPSState) awareness of SPS.
Main Methods:
- An online experimental study involving 175 participants.
- Measurement of general tendency (SPSTrait) and in-the-moment awareness (SPSState) of SPS.
- Assessment of endogenous visual attention using a Posner task.
Main Results:
- Habitual SPS (SPSTrait) were reported more frequently for the whole body than for the feet, indicating a broader body representation.
- Momentary SPS (SPSState) did not differ significantly across body parts.
- Neither SPSTrait nor SPSState showed a correlation with performance on the visual attention task.
Conclusions:
- Findings suggest a representational distinction in body perception.
- SPSTrait may be linked to top-down somatorepresentation (a global body model).
- SPSState might originate from bottom-up somatosensory processing.
